Probabilistic counting
WebbApproximate Counting • Information Theory: need log2 N bits to count till N. • Approximate counting: use log2 logN + O(1) for ε–approximation, in relative terms and in probability. How to find an unbounded integer while posing few questions? WebbProbability gives a measure of how likely it is for something to happen. It can be defined as follows: Definition of probability: Consider a very large number of identical trials of a …
Probabilistic counting
Did you know?
Webb27 maj 2024 · The main idea of probabilistic counting is taking into account the next event with a certain probability. Let us first consider an example with a constant update rate: \(\begin{equation*} C_{n+1} = \left\{\begin{array}{ll} C_n + 1 & \textit{with probability $p = const$} \\ C_n & \textit{with probability $1-p$.} \end{array}\right. \end{equation*}\) Webb1 juni 1990 · We present a probabilistic algorithm for counting the number of unique values in the presence of duplicates. This algorithm has O (q) time complexity, where q is the number of values including...
Webb2 Probabilistic Counting, problems of the trivial approach. The main idea of probabilistic counting is taking into account the next event with a certain probability. Let us first consider an example with a constant update rate: Where denotes the counter value after the th update attempt. WebbThe probability is theoretical because the result only approximates the true value. The probability is experimental because it is determined by observing actual events. The probability is theoretical because it counts all favorable and all possible outcomes. The probability is experimental because the method is considered controversial.
WebbProbabilistic counting algorithms for data base applications Information systems Data management systems Database design and models Physical data models Information retrieval Information storage systems Mathematics of computing Discrete mathematics Combinatorics Permutations and combinations Mathematical analysis Numerical analysis Webbthan the best known prior algorithm, probabilistic count-ing [8], but introduce a whole family of counting algorithms that further improve performance by taking advantage of particularities of the specific counting application. Our adaptive bitmap, using the fact that the number of active flows doesn’t change very rapidly, can count the ...
Webb31 dec. 2012 · Linear Counting(以下简称LC)在1990年的一篇论文“A linear-time probabilistic counting algorithm for database applications”中被提出。 作为一个早期的基数估计算法,LC在空间复杂度方面并不算优秀,实际上LC的空间复杂度与上文中简单bitmap方法是一样的(但是有个常数项级别的降低),都是\(O(N_{max})\),因此目前 ...
Webb1 jan. 2005 · Introduction to Counting & Probability (The Art of Problem Solving) $43.00. (26) In Stock. Learn the basics of counting and … dick\\u0027s sporting goods lincoln neWebbFind step-by-step Computer science solutions and your answer to the following textbook question: With a b-bit counter, we can ordinarily only count up to $$ 2^b - 1 $$ . With R. Morris’s probabilistic counting, we can count up to a much larger value at the expense of some loss of precision. We let a counter value of i represent a count of $$ n_i $$ for $$ i … dick\u0027s sporting goods lincoln nebraskaWebb14 Flajolet-Martin algorithm (intuitive, hand-waving explanation) Let r(u) be the number of trailing zeros in hash value, keep R = max r(u), output 2R as estimate Repeated items don’t change our estimates because their hashes are equal About 1⁄2 of distinct items hash to *****0 – To actually see a *****0, we expect to wait until seeing 2 distinct items city by the sea trailerWebbWe describe our full approximate counting algorithm in Algorithm 1. The counter is initialized via the Init() procedure, and each increment to Nand query for an estimate of Nare described in the pseudocode, following the ideas set forth in Subsection 1.2. dick\u0027s sporting goods lincoln plazaWebbProbabilistic counting Abstract: We present here a class of probabilistic algorithms with which one can estimate the number of distinct elements in a collection of data (typically a large file stored on disk) in a single pass, using only 0 (1) auxiliary storage and 0 (1) operations per element. city by tulip inn sindelfingenWebbA PROBABILISTIC COUNTING PROCEDURE AND ITS ANALYSIS The Basic Counting Procedure We assume here that we have at our disposal a hashing function hash of the type: function hash(x: records): scalar range [0 .,. . 2L - 11, that transforms records into integers sufficiently uniformly distributed over the dick\u0027s sporting goods linehttp://pages.di.unipi.it/ferragina/dott2014/sketches.pdf city by tulip inn düsseldorf